The E-BOX goes digital

Display for intuitive operation
Today, it’s impossible to imagine everyday life without a smartphone. The wide range of applications and the benefits of digital technology are simply too vast. In motorhomes, however, analogue technology is still predominate, and the vehicle’s electrical system is controlled via simple analogue control panels. The fill level is indicated by individual LEDs in 25 per cent increments. There are no clear text messages, for example when the freshwater tank is running low, let alone the option to control the heating via the same display.
However, a new trend is emerging in the market. And so, E-T-A's E-BOX , the world’s first all-in-one power distribution unit with charging and booster functions, is going digital. The advantages are obvious: Third-party systems such as the heating, air conditioning, batteries, fridge and the like can conveniently be controlled and monitored via one display.
Users receive clear text messages for conditions that require attention or action. If, for example, the freshwater tank runs low, text messages will explain how to top it up. Another text message is sent for example, if the freshwater pump has been deactivated because the wastewater tank is full. This proves to be a particular advantage for occasional campers or those new to camping. The system helps with operating and using the motorhome, allowing you to enjoy your well-deserved holiday to the fullest. Furthermore, the display enhances the vehicle’s intrinsic value, As the display language can be changed, and the interface is generally more intuitive.
